Analyzing the types of betting odds
Betting odds can be categorized into three main formats: fractional, decimal, and moneyline. Fractional odds represent the profit relative to the stake; for example, odds of 5/1 mean you win $5 for every $1 bet. Decimal odds, more widely used in European markets, show the total amount returned if successful, including the stake. For instance, 6.0 odds mean a $1 bet returns $6. Moneyline odds are more common in the United States and can be positive or negative; positive odds (e.g., +300) indicate potential profit on a $100 bet, whereas negative odds (e.g., -150) indicate how much you need to wager to win $100. By analyzing these odds, bettors can make more accurate assessments of events and plan their bets strategically.

Bankroll management techniques for smart bettors
Effective bankroll management involves setting a budget for your gambling activities and sticking to it. Here are some techniques to consider: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much money you can afford to lose and only gamble that amount.
- Unit Betting: Establish a unit size that represents a small percentage of your total bankroll. For example, using 1-5% per bet can help you weather losing streaks.
- Adjust Accordingly: With a fluctuating bankroll, adjust your bet sizes in relation to your total funds. Increase your stakes during winning streaks and lessen them during losses to protect your bankroll.
- Track Your Bets: Keeping a record of your betting history helps identify successful strategies and areas needing improvement.

Understanding market trends and betting patterns
Market trends can significantly affect betting odds. Observing how the odds change in reaction to betting volumes or news about teams can reveal which side the public leans towards. Notably, betting against the public sentiment, when the public heavily favors one side, often leads to value opportunities. Furthermore, paying attention to notable betting patterns – such as "sharp money" from professional gamblers or line movements – can offer valuable insights into how to approach your wagers.

Major sports leagues and their unique betting lines
Each major sports league has distinct betting lines that appeal to different types of bettors. In football (soccer), for instance, you might encounter Asian handicaps, which require understanding more complex bet types. In American football, point spreads are common, while basketball often features totals (over/under bets). Familiarizing yourself with each league's specific nuances will allow you to navigate bet types effectively and make well-informed choices.

How to interpret spread and total lines effectively
Spread betting and total lines require a solid understanding of both game mechanics and statistical analysis. Spread betting involves wagering on the margin of victory in a game. For example, if Team A is favored by -5.5 points, they must win by at least six points to cover the spread. Total lines, on the other hand, denote the combined score of both teams. Understanding how to interpret and analyze these lines can significantly influence your betting strategy.
